If you are the owner of a PC, not a laptop, the hard drive must be securely fixed in the system unit. You can do this in three ways:

  1. Bolt fastening. Often, the hard drive is attached with just two bolts, although there are more connectors. In the "sled" the disk "feels" freely and because of this creates a crackle and noise. It is worth stretching the device and securely fasten the hard drive to all the bolts.

  1. Use of pads. Soft rubberized pads dampen noise and vibration. You can buy them or cut them yourself and install them at the point of contact between the disk and the system unit. However, the material should not be too large so as not to interfere with the ventilation of the disc.

  1. Mounting with twisted pair. Usually, 3-4 small pieces of wire are used for this purpose and fastened as if the disk were located in the sled. However, in this case, it will be difficult to move the body. There is a risk of damaging the device.

Using the above methods, you can fix the hard drive so that it does not make noise or crack.

As we said in the article - there are two sources of noise from the HDD:

  • From the rotation of magnetic disks
  • From hitting a block with heads on the stroke limiter

There is nothing we can do about disk rotation noise. Is it just to buy. But with the blows of the head block, as with the source of the main noise, you can and should fight. Vibrations also arise from the impact, and if they are not dampened, the situation will worsen.

Using Automatic Acoustic Management to Reduce HDD Noise

Automatic Acoustic Management - automatic control storage noise.

In addition to this function, hard drive manufacturers use special shock-absorbing pads that effectively suppress cracking. This is not always enough and not for everyone. And if not enough, you need to use AAM. This function controls the positioning speed of the head block. You can set a numerical value from 128 to 254. The larger the number, the higher the speed and, accordingly, more vibration and, as a result, noise.

There are many programs for managing AAM. Of the simplest, I can recommend WinAAM. There you can set only two positions 128 or 254. That is, either quietly and slowly, or loudly and quickly.

We will use the HDDScan program, which allows you to set any value from 128 to 254, and thus you can flexibly adjust the noise level from your .

3) Reduce the positioning speed of the block with heads (Automatic Acoustic Management)

Hard drives have certain options that are usually not mentioned anywhere (we are now talking about Automatic Acoustic Management, often abbreviated AAM). This option allows you to reduce the speed of moving the heads, and this, in turn, has a positive effect on the noise level (although, besides this, the speed of the disk is somewhat reduced, but "by eye" imperceptibly).

You can change this setting in special utilities, I recommend the following: quietHDD, HDDScan. I will consider the work in both utilities.
